Category: Technology

Technology (from Greek τέχνη, techne, “art, skill, cunning of hand”; and -λογία, -logia) is the collection of techniques, skills, methods and processes used in the production of goods or services or in the accomplishment of objectives, such as scientific investigation. Technology can be the knowledge of techniques, processes, etc. or it can be embedded in machines, computers, devices and factories, which can be operated by individuals without detailed knowledge of the workings of such things.

Cooperative Video Games Play Elicits Pro-social Behavior

Cooperative Video Games Play Elicits Pro-social Behavior

0

A 2015 study examined aggressive behavior between people playing games cooperatively, competitively and by themselves. It seems interacting in video games cooperatively with others can lead to extensive benefits by making players think helpful behaviors are beneficial and natural.

Action Video Games Bolster Sensorimotor Skills

Action Video Games Bolster Sensorimotor Skills

0

Psychology researchers have discovered that folks who play action video games like Battlefield or Counter-Strike seem to gain a new sensorimotor skill more swiftly than non-gamers.
